New York, New York

The Greenwich Village Halloween Parade has become known as one of the biggest Halloween celebrations in the world. Over 50,000 people celebrate it by dressing up in their best scary, freaky or just plain ratchet costumes.

There are marching bands, giant puppets and dancers! Around two million people crowd on 6th Ave. from Spring to 16th Street to watch, so you’ll want to find your spot a few hours in advance. Another great stop to make while you’re in town is the after-dark Crypt Crawl under the Cathedral of St. John!

San Francisco, California

Home to one of the most frightening things I have ever done….Alcatraz After Dark, San Fran is a must-see for those who are not faint of heart. A creepy cruise through the cold and choppy waters of San Fran lead you to an island that housed the most infamous prison in America from 1934 to 1963. San Fran is also the perfect location for those that want to party, as every year it hosts hundreds of fright clubs around the city!

Savannah, Georgia

With a history that includes horrible fires, big hurricanes, Civil War battles and world-famous murder trials, Savannah is widely considered to be the most haunted city in all America. Many of the city’s Victorian styled hotels and B&B’s host Fright Night room packages plus their graveyard, haunted house and ghost tours are the most terrifying you will find!
